Requirements

  • DVM / VMD (or equivalent)
  • Eligible to work in the US
  • Passion for high‑quality small animal medicine
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• DVM/VMD degree or equivalent from an AVMA‑accredited university
  • NAVLE certification
  • ECFVG or PAVE (if graduated from a non‑AVMA accredited program)
  • DEA, State, and USDA licenses (or ability to obtain upon hire)
